What is Maintenance Allowance To Backward Class Students Under Training In Sainik Schools?
The scheme “Maintenance Allowance to Backward Class Students Under Training in Sainik School” is a Scholarship Scheme by the Social Justice and Special Assistance Department, Government of Maharashtra.

Benefits
1. The training fees ₹400/- to ₹2400/- (as per course) are paid to the concerned I.T.I. 1. After completion of training, one Tool Kit of ₹1000/- is provided to the trainee through the concerned Govt. I.T.I.
